A tasty spot for fresh Vietnamese food has opened its doors in Burlington.
Dear Saigon is now open at 2405 Fairview Street, serving up a varied menu of Vietnamese dishes including hearty and comforting pho, vermicelli noodle bowls, Tom Yum soups, rice plates with proteins like lemongrass beef or grilled pork, and beyond.
The restaurant is the first Hamilton-Burlington area location of a Toronto restaurant chain founded in 2014, and their success allowed them to grow to further locations in North York, Scarborough, and Richmond Hill before opening this latest Burlington spot.
“With each bowl of pho, we have thrown in our passion for food and love for our hometown,” writes Dear Saigon on their website.
Available for dine-in and takeout, this place keeps it simple and modern with its authentic Vietnamese offerings, and pho lovers of Burlington are sure to be excited for this new addition to the local food scene!
